3772.034 [Effective 9/10/2010] Immunity from liability.

3772.034 [Effective 9/10/2010] Immunity from liability.

Absent gross negligence, a casino operator, management company, holding company, gaming-related vendor, the state, and employees of those entities are entitled to immunity from any type of civil liability if a person participating in the voluntary exclusion program enters a casino facility.

Added by 128th General Assembly File No. 38, HB 519, § 1, eff. 9/10/2010.
